Understanding the Benefits of PDFs in Tax Preparation

PDFs, or Portable Document Format files, have become the standard for sharing and storing important documents. Their compatibility across different devices and operating systems is a significant advantage. When it comes to tax preparation, using PDFs offers several benefits:

  • Accessibility: PDFs can be easily accessed on any device, whether it’s a computer, tablet, or smartphone.
  • Security: PDFs can be password-protected, ensuring your sensitive tax information remains confidential.
  • Consistency: The formatting of PDFs remains intact, preserving the layout of your documents regardless of where they are viewed.

These advantages make PDFs a powerful tool in your tax preparation arsenal. They help keep your documents organized and accessible, which can save you time and reduce stress during tax season.

Organizing Your Tax Documents with PDFs

The key to efficient tax preparation lies in organization. Instead of sifting through piles of paper, consider converting your tax documents to PDFs. Start by creating a dedicated folder on your computer or cloud storage. Name it something straightforward like “Tax Documents 2023.” Within this folder, you can create subfolders for different categories, such as:

  • Income Statements
  • Deductions
  • Receipts
  • Previous Year’s Returns

Digitizing Paper Documents

If you’re still relying on paper documents, now’s the time to make the switch. Scanning your paper documents and saving them as PDFs provides a digital backup that is less likely to be lost or damaged. Most smartphones come equipped with scanning apps that allow you to take clear pictures of your documents and convert them into PDFs.

When digitizing, make sure to name the files clearly and save them in the appropriate subfolders you created earlier. This way, you won’t waste time searching for a specific document later on.

Utilizing PDF Editing Tools

Once your documents are in PDF format, you might need to make adjustments. PDF editing tools can allow you to fill out tax forms digitally, add annotations, or even combine multiple PDFs into one document. This can be particularly useful if you have multiple forms that need to be submitted together.

Look for tools that offer features such as:

  • Form filling capabilities
  • Annotation tools for notes or reminders
  • Merge and split functionalities

By taking advantage of these features, you can streamline your tax preparation process even further.

Storing Your PDFs Securely

After your tax documents are organized and edited, the next step is to store them securely. Cloud storage solutions like Google Drive or Dropbox offer excellent options for keeping your PDFs safe and accessible. Not only do they provide backup in case your computer fails, but they also allow you to access your documents from anywhere with an internet connection.

Don’t forget to implement additional security measures. Use strong, unique passwords for your cloud accounts, and consider enabling two-factor authentication for an added layer of protection. This way, your sensitive tax information remains secure.

Preparing for Future Tax Seasons

Once you’ve mastered the process of using PDFs for your tax preparation, consider setting up a system that works for you year-round. Regularly updating your tax folder with new documents can alleviate the last-minute rush when tax season arrives.

For example, make it a habit to scan and save any tax-related documents as they come in. This will ensure that when the time to file arrives, you’re not scrambling to find important receipts or statements. An organized approach not only simplifies the current year’s taxes but also sets a solid foundation for the future.
